Santa’s Joy Ride In Deer Park This Week

Photo by: Jesson Mata

Spokane County Fire District 4 firefighters will be escorting Santa through Deer Park neighborhoods this week. Starting tonight, families can catch a glimpse of Santa’s sleigh and his entourage of local heroes! Read on to learn about this festive event’s specific locations and times.

Santa Claus is coming to town!  He will be joyriding the streets of Deer Park with his friends from Spokane County Fire District 4. This festive crew travels to bring joy to the community and spread cheer to residents of all ages. Deer Park residents will have the opportunity to see Santa and his firefighter companions on four different days this week. Each day’s journey will take place between 6pm and 9pm. 

  • On December 18th, they will cover the area north of Crawford Street and west of Colville Road. 
  • On December 19th, Santa and friends will visit neighborhoods north of Crawford Street and east of Colville Road. 
  • On December 20th, the group will make their way through neighborhoods south of Crawford Street and east of Colville Road. 
  • On December 21st, they will wrap up their tour in neighborhoods south of Crawford Street and west of Colville Road.


December 22nd will serve as a makeup day if, for some reason, a day or location was not reached, ensuring every child has a chance to see Santa. 

Below is a map provided by the Spokane County Fire District that shows each day’s quadrants.

As the sirens echo through the streets and the twinkling lights of Santa’s sleigh illuminate the night sky, Deer Park residents can look forward to a festive experience. So, bundle up the family, step outside, and join the community in waving to Santa as he passes by, accompanied by the firefighters of Spokane County Fire District 4.
